Building partnerships with local media outlets can be a powerful strategy to boost attendance at your meetings and events. By collaborating with newspapers, radio stations, and community blogs, organizations can reach a broader audience and generate greater interest.
Why Local Media Partnerships Matter
Local media outlets have established trust and a dedicated audience within the community. Partnering with them allows your organization to tap into this existing network, increasing visibility and credibility for your events.
Strategies to Leverage Local Media
- Press Releases: Send well-crafted press releases about upcoming meetings, highlighting key topics and speakers.
- Media Interviews: Arrange interviews with organization leaders to discuss the importance of the meeting and encourage attendance.
- Event Coverage: Invite media representatives to cover the event, creating future promotional opportunities.
- Community Calendar Listings: Ensure your event is listed in local newspapers and online community calendars.
- Partnerships for Promotions: Collaborate on special promotions or contests that incentivize attendance.
Tips for Success
To maximize the impact of your media partnerships, consider the following tips:
- Build Relationships: Develop genuine relationships with local journalists and media staff.
- Provide Clear Information: Make it easy for media to cover your event with concise details and visuals.
- Follow Up: After the event, share photos and summaries to encourage future coverage.
- Maintain Consistency: Regularly communicate with media outlets to keep your organization top of mind.
